At the heart of Khwansari’s teachings lies the doctrine of Imamate, which posits that the spiritual and temporal leadership of the Muslim community is vested in the Imams, divinely appointed successors of the Prophet Muhammad. Khwansari articulated this concept with a fervor that transcends mere doctrinal affirmation; he illuminated the Imams’ role as infallible guides, whose wisdom and insight are indispensable for discerning the complexities of life and faith. In his view, the Imamate is not merely a historical or political office but a divine mandate infused with esoteric significance.
